MinimOSD dla Multiwii

FC oparte na Arduino

Moderatorzy: moderatorzy2014, moderatorzy

Awatar użytkownika
rycerz100
Posty: 992
Rejestracja: piątek 23 gru 2011, 13:08
Lokalizacja: Warszawa

Post autor: rycerz100 »

Sorki że post pod postem ale nikt nie zauważy.
Rurku ale na FTDI nie ma czegoś takiego jak CTR
Jest tylko z wolnych RST DTR i CTS
Które z wyjść miałeś na myśli pisząc

"bym Ci od razu napisał że z FTDI pin CTR lutujesz do pinu GRN na OSD i wsjo hula bez czajenia się na ręczne resety"
I to zamiast kabelka masy?
Ostatnio zmieniony wtorek 05 mar 2013, 16:03 przez rycerz100, łącznie zmieniany 1 raz.
Mirek
Awatar użytkownika
mkrawcz1
Posty: 1772
Rejestracja: piątek 18 lut 2011, 11:38
Lokalizacja: Warszawa-Wilanów

Post autor: mkrawcz1 »

DTR zapewne :-)
Doświadczenie - wiedza, którą zdobyłeś tuż po tym, kiedy była ci najbardziej potrzebna...
Awatar użytkownika
MatManiak
Posty: 705
Rejestracja: czwartek 18 paź 2012, 11:45
Lokalizacja: Siemianowice Śl.

Post autor: MatManiak »

Ani nie CTR ani nie DTR, tylko RTS - jak w każdym Arduino (na arduino jest oparne minimOSD) z ft232rl na pokładzie, reset procka jest wykonywany linią RTS ;)
S500 | ZMR250 | HK FPV250 | Sky Surfer II 1400 | Wing Wing Z-84 | Reely Rhino II
Awatar użytkownika
rycerz100
Posty: 992
Rejestracja: piątek 23 gru 2011, 13:08
Lokalizacja: Warszawa

Post autor: rycerz100 »

Nie mam już cierpliwości do tego gu..a :evil:
Panowie na litość Bogdana z Bogdańca czy kogo tam chcecie bardzo was proszę niech jedna osoba napisze w jednym poście co gdzie wetknąć
OSD Programator
Jak ktoś kto nie ma zielonego pojęcia jak ja o takich rzeczach a będzie chciał sam to zrobić to zgłupieje kompletnie czytając ten temat i wypowiedzi w nim :-/
Kto kompetentny uzupełni bazgroła ? :-P
Obrazek
Mirek
Awatar użytkownika
Rurek
Posty: 16419
Rejestracja: środa 10 mar 2010, 15:21
Lokalizacja: AIP ENR 5.5 - AAA 153 :-)

Post autor: Rurek »

MatManiak pisze:Ani nie CTR ani nie DTR, tylko RTS - jak w każdym Arduino (na arduino jest oparne minimOSD) z ft232rl na pokładzie, reset procka jest wykonywany linią RTS ;)
MatManiak wie jak zwykle lepiej bo zapewne używał mojego interfejsu FTDI :-)
A tymczasem to mkrawcz1 ma rację :-)
Sorry pomyliłem nazwy Mirku, of korzzz jest to DTR na interfejsie FTDI.
Od trzech lat programuję różne arduino podobne i arduina właśnie tym dinksem i tym sygnałem resetuje się Arduino. Matmaniak doczytaj :-)
infekcja FPV postępuje w zastraszającym tempie...
Awatar użytkownika
shaggee
Posty: 2718
Rejestracja: piątek 03 lut 2012, 00:32
Lokalizacja: Poznań/Kalisz

Post autor: shaggee »

rycerz100 pisze:
A tak przy okazji potrafisz wyłączyć dosłownie wszystko co się wyświetla z tego OSD ?
Potrzebuję pusty szary ekran :-)
Podsyłam plik do pustego szarego ekranu. Musisz to wgrać tak jak czcionki. Czyli programować płytkę od początku tak jak w pierwszym poście tylko podmienić plik Rushduino.mcm

http://speedy.sh/UVXWd/Rushduino.mcm
Awatar użytkownika
rycerz100
Posty: 992
Rejestracja: piątek 23 gru 2011, 13:08
Lokalizacja: Warszawa

Post autor: rycerz100 »

Dobra sprawdziłem ma być dokładnie tak i na tym z połączeniami finito :-)
Obrazek
Mirek
Awatar użytkownika
shaggee
Posty: 2718
Rejestracja: piątek 03 lut 2012, 00:32
Lokalizacja: Poznań/Kalisz

Post autor: shaggee »

Dodałem w pierwszym poście linki do najnowszego oprogramowania. Uprościła się metoda programowania płytki. Doszło GUI w którym możemy sobie wszystko włączać, wyłączać, kalibrować, zmieniać czcionki a nawet symulować działanie czujników.
Awatar użytkownika
rycerz100
Posty: 992
Rejestracja: piątek 23 gru 2011, 13:08
Lokalizacja: Warszawa

Post autor: rycerz100 »

Bardzo dziękuję w imieniu swoim i całej wspólnoty ;-)
Powiedz jeszcze co z tym zrobić.

Na 2 kompach jest to samo Win 7 i Win XP
nawet po puszczeniu pliku który dodałeś nic
Mirek
Awatar użytkownika
shaggee
Posty: 2718
Rejestracja: piątek 03 lut 2012, 00:32
Lokalizacja: Poznań/Kalisz

Post autor: shaggee »

Panie zrób przez GUI. Napisałem nową instrukcje (rozdział III). Zobacz jak łatwo pójdzie.
Awatar użytkownika
MatManiak
Posty: 705
Rejestracja: czwartek 18 paź 2012, 11:45
Lokalizacja: Siemianowice Śl.

Post autor: MatManiak »

Rurek pisze:
MatManiak pisze:Ani nie CTR ani nie DTR, tylko RTS - jak w każdym Arduino (na arduino jest oparne minimOSD) z ft232rl na pokładzie, reset procka jest wykonywany linią RTS ;)
MatManiak wie jak zwykle lepiej bo zapewne używał mojego interfejsu FTDI :-)
A tymczasem to mkrawcz1 ma rację :-)
Sorry pomyliłem nazwy Mirku, of korzzz jest to DTR na interfejsie FTDI.
Od trzech lat programuję różne arduino podobne i arduina właśnie tym dinksem i tym sygnałem resetuje się Arduino. Matmaniak doczytaj :-)
Rurku, doczytaj ;) Co prawda w różnych projektach jest różnie, bo czasem używa się DTR a czasem RTS (a np. adruino duemilanove ma podpięte obydwie te linie do resetu), więc obydwaj mieliśmy racje. Mam 6 różnych arduino w domu, zbudowałem z 20 własnych układów z bootloaderem arduino na atmedze328p, mam 3 przejscówki FTDI i zawszę daję reset przez opornik 10k do Vcc i bezpośrednio do RTS - działa, sprawdź ;)

No ale mało ważne, przyznaję, że może być DTR, choć nie zgodzę się, że nie miałem racji ;)

Dla tych co nie kapują o co chodzi, wyjaśnienie: obojętnie ;)
S500 | ZMR250 | HK FPV250 | Sky Surfer II 1400 | Wing Wing Z-84 | Reely Rhino II
Awatar użytkownika
shaggee
Posty: 2718
Rejestracja: piątek 03 lut 2012, 00:32
Lokalizacja: Poznań/Kalisz

Post autor: shaggee »

Hmm z tego minimOSD wychodzi fajny tracker antenowy :)
Awatar użytkownika
Rurek
Posty: 16419
Rejestracja: środa 10 mar 2010, 15:21
Lokalizacja: AIP ENR 5.5 - AAA 153 :-)

Post autor: Rurek »

Opisz lepiej póki co jak czujnik temperatury z tym bangla...
infekcja FPV postępuje w zastraszającym tempie...
Awatar użytkownika
shaggee
Posty: 2718
Rejestracja: piątek 03 lut 2012, 00:32
Lokalizacja: Poznań/Kalisz

Post autor: shaggee »

Rurek pisze:Opisz lepiej póki co jak czujnik temperatury z tym bangla...
W globalvariables.h zmień:

Kod: Zaznacz cały

const uint8_t temperaturePin=6;
na

Kod: Zaznacz cały

const uint8_t temperaturePin=5;
Podlutuj girę czujnika pod analog pin 5 atmegi tak jak niżej i w GUI włącz display temperature:

Obrazek
Awatar użytkownika
Rurek
Posty: 16419
Rejestracja: środa 10 mar 2010, 15:21
Lokalizacja: AIP ENR 5.5 - AAA 153 :-)

Post autor: Rurek »

Ciekawostka...na hobbykingu pojawił się w wersji 1.1 : http://www.hobbyking.com/hobbyking/stor ... duct=36844
O co kamon?
infekcja FPV postępuje w zastraszającym tempie...
ODPOWIEDZ